Validation of the Body Compassion Scale in multiple sclerosis.

Erin G Mistretta1, Jennifer K Altman1, Lindsey M Knowles1

  • 1Department of Rehabilitation Medicine, University of Washington, School of Medicine.

Rehabilitation Psychology
|May 27, 2025
PubMed
Summary

The Body Compassion Scale (BCS) shows a valid three-factor structure for individuals with multiple sclerosis (MS). This scale helps assess body compassion in chronic health conditions.

Area of Science:

  • Psychology
  • Health Psychology
  • Psychometrics

Background:

  • The Body Compassion Scale (BCS) measures body acceptance, common humanity, and defusion.
  • Previous validation was limited to healthy undergraduate samples.
  • Psychometric properties in chronic health conditions remain understudied.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To evaluate the factor structure of the Body Compassion Scale (BCS).
  • To assess the psychometric properties of the BCS in individuals with multiple sclerosis (MS).

Main Methods:

  • An online survey assessed body compassion, fatigue, pain, cognitive functioning, disability, depression, anxiety, and resilience.
  • 677 individuals with multiple sclerosis (MS) participated.
  • Data analysis focused on the factor structure of the BCS.

Main Results:

  • A three-factor structure (defusion, common humanity, acceptance) best fit the data.
  • All BCS subscores demonstrated acceptable internal consistency.
  • Preliminary validity evidence for the BCS in the MS sample was found.

Conclusions:

  • The BCS exhibits a valid three-factor structure in individuals with MS.
  • Findings support the use of the BCS for assessing body compassion in people with MS.
  • The BCS may be applicable to other rehabilitation populations.
